Abstract
A measuring method is provided for monitoring a component of an electrical assembly, in which the voltage across at least one component of the electrical assembly and a current through the component are measured, and in which, from measurement values for the voltage and the current, a resistance value of the component is determined. The voltage and the current are measured in successive switching periods of a periodic switching signal of the electrical assembly, and the resistance value is determined based on the measurement values for voltage and current from the successive switching periods. A measuring circuit for monitoring a component of an electrical assembly is provided with an analog/digital converter. An electrical assembly, in particular a switching power supply, having such a measuring circuit is also provided.
